Pearrygin Lake

Overview

Pearrygin Lake State Park offers a quintessential Methow Valley experience centered around a sprawling freshwater lake. Surrounded by rolling sagebrush hills and distant mountain peaks, this expansive 1,200-acre park serves as a hub for outdoor recreation. Visitors often choose this destination for its spacious campsites and the rare combination of high-desert scenery paired with lush shoreline access. It is a well-maintained facility that balances the natural beauty of North Central Washington with modern conveniences for travelers.

Location & Surroundings

Tucked away just north of the charming town of Winthrop, the park provides a sense of seclusion without sacrificing proximity to local culture. The landscape is characterized by expansive lake views and dramatic seasonal changes, from vibrant spring wildflowers to golden autumn grasses. Its position in the Methow Valley makes it a prime basecamp for exploring the eastern slopes of the North Cascades. The surrounding terrain is open and airy, offering excellent stargazing opportunities away from major light pollution.

Amenities & Park Features

The park is split into different camping areas, catering to various RV sizes and needs. The East Campground is particularly popular for RVers as it features full-hookup sites including water, sewer, and electricity. On-site facilities include clean restrooms, heated showers, and a convenient dump station. For recreation within the park, travelers enjoy a designated swimming beach, multiple boat launches, and a sprawling pier. The park also maintains several miles of hiking trails that wind through the hills and along the water.

Nearby Attractions & Things to Do

A short drive takes you to the Western-themed town of Winthrop, where you can stroll along wooden boardwalks and visit local shops. Fishing enthusiasts will find the lake stocked with rainbow trout, while the nearby Methow River is famous for fly fishing. During the summer, the Rex Derr Trail offers a four-mile loop with panoramic views of the valley. Those looking for adventure can head west to North Cascades National Park for some of the state's most rugged alpine scenery.
